Cheesy Grits

main dish

6 cup water
1 teaspoon salt
2 cup quick cooking grits
3 cup milk
1 each stick butter
2 each cloves garlic, minced
4 each eggs
2 cup grated sharp cheddar cheese

Butter 4 quart casserole, and set aside. In large heavy saucepan, bring water and salt to a boil over high heat. Add grits, stirring to prevent lumping. Stir in milk, then bring mixture to a boil. Reduce heat, and simmer 5 minutes. In small saucepan, combine butter and garlic over medium heat. Cook butter and garlic, stirring constantly, until garlic becomes aromatic. Add garlic butter mixture to grits. Place eggs in small mixing bowl, and beat slightly with a wire wisk. Stir 1 cup of hot grits into beaten eggs. Add egg mixture to grits in saucepan, and stir to blend. Remove grits from heat. Stir in 1 1/2 cups cheese until blended. Pour mixture into prepared casserole and sprinkle with remaining cheese. Bake at 400 degrees, till grits are brown around the edges. If desired, chill before baking, then cook at 350 degrees, for 1 hour, for firmer grits.

Yield: 12 servings
